Epigenetic modifier modulator CS-014 shows good clot prevention profile in vivo

Aug. 30, 2023
Under pathologic conditions such as vascular injury or atherosclerosis, the hyperactivation of platelets may lead to occlusive thrombus formation, myocardial infarction or stroke. Although there are several targets for clot prevention validated clinically, these strategies may present bleeding risk as a limitation. Researchers from the University of Michigan have reported on CS-014, a histone deacetylase (HDAC) inhibitor aimed to reduce clot formation without risk of bleeding.

Potent and orally bioavailable pyridine-N-oxide FXIa inhibitor from Janssen presented

Aug. 22, 2023
Protease form factor Xia (FXIa) is a therapeutic target for thrombosis prevention due to its well-known contribution to VTE and ischemic stroke in humans. Researchers from Janssen Pharmaceutica NV presented an antithrombotic target FXIa inhibitor obtained through a non-classical interactions strategy to improve the pharmacokinetic and pharmacological activity for the treatment of thrombosis. In the series, the potency was increased by using water-mediated hydrogen bonds to reduce polar hydrogen bond donors and using methyl to displace high-energy waters.

Targeting cell-bound β-2-glycoprotein I: rtPA-coated nanobubbles for thrombus-specific lysis

July 13, 2023
Antibodies against β-2-glycoprotein I (β-2-GPI) play a crucial role in thrombus formation in conditions such as antiphospholipid syndrome (APS). Despite the efficacy of recombinant tissue plasminogen activator (rtPA) in patients with APS, this therapy presents significant limitations, including safety concerns.

Bioxodes turning tick’s trick into stroke drug

June 19, 2023
By Cormac Sheridan
Could a bioactive peptide secreted in the saliva of ticks offer a useful therapy for people who have experienced intracerebral hemorrhage (ICH)? That’s the question Bioxodes SA has set out to answer, and the company is about to move its first-in-class drug candidate, Ir-CPI, which has dual anti-thrombotic and anti-inflammatory effects, into a phase IIa trial in patients with ICH.

Aidoc publishes a new study on its AI system for incidental PE on CT

May 11, 2023
By Bernard Banga
Aidoc Medical Ltd. has just presented a study using its AI tool in the Netherlands Cancers Institute for detection and worklist prioritization to diagnose incidental pulmonary embolism at routine contrast-enhanced chest CT. The results published in Radiology: Cardiothoracic Imaging show a reduction by 15% of the missed rate of incidental pulmonary embolism and by more than 98% of the notification time for positive incidental pulmonary embolism. “Our AI system gives a response related to the interpretation, quantification and workflow management,” Elad Walach, co-founder and CEO of Aidoc Medical, told BioWorld. Due to the growing volume of radiology examinations, particularly in thoracic imaging, and the lack of supply radiologists, the delay between the CT examinations and their interpretation has increased significantly in many practices. This is particularly true for pulmonary embolism (PE).

Blood thinner class dissolves blood clots without increasing bleeding risk

May 3, 2023
By Subhasree Nag
Blood clots can lead to life-threatening conditions such as deep vein thrombosis, heart attack, pulmonary embolism and stroke. Blood thinners are essential in the treatment and prevention of blood clots but carry a significant risk of bleeding as they target enzymes essential for blood clotting. Researchers at the University of British Columbia (UBC) and the University of Michigan have developed a new class of blood thinners that can specifically target clots without increasing the risk of bleeding.

Cereno Scientific reports preclinical safety and efficacy of CS-585 in prevention of thrombotic events

March 7, 2023
Current antithrombotic therapies for the prevention and management of cardiovascular disorders such as thrombosis, myocardial infarction (MI) or stroke present an associated risk of bleeding. The essential events leading to the formation of hemostatic clots are platelet activation and fibrin formation. When activated, the prostacyclin (IP) receptor prevents platelet aggregation in arteries and veins after injury.

Hemab, ‘an Alexion five years from now,’ closes $135M series B

Feb. 21, 2023
By Cormac Sheridan
Hemab Therapeutics ApS raised $135 million in a series B funding round to continue its broad effort to build a company focused on developing prophylactic therapies for neglected bleeding and thrombotic disorders. The new cash brings its total equity raise to $190 million.
